Every circuit board safety-certified by Underwriters Laboratories carries a unique tracking identifier. Understanding what this number does—and does not—tell you is crucial for a successful schematic search: The search for "ASUS laptop I/O board E82152"

The search for "E82152 schematic" can also lead to results from UL (Underwriters Laboratories) Product iQ databases. In this context, "E82152" appears as a UL File Number assigned to Gold Circuit Electronics Ltd. , a manufacturer of printed wiring boards (PCBs). While this confirms that PCBs with this code were certified for safety in 2021, a UL listing does not provide the board's circuit design.

The identifier is a UL File Number belonging to Gold Circuit Electronics Ltd , a major Taiwanese manufacturer of high-density interconnect (HDI) printed circuit boards (PCBs).

E82152 identifies the raw board supplier (Gold Circuit Electronics).

A schematic alone does not reveal where a physical component sits on a multi-layered circuit board. Combining a schematic with a corresponding allows a technician to click a damaged resistor pad on their screen and instantly identify every trace connection across all internal layers of the substrate. This integration is essential for diagnosing broken traces hidden deep beneath surface-mounted components.
